Helen Sitter Mode Staley, age 72 of Maryville, passed away May 19, 2019. She was a graduate of Everett High School - Class of 1966. She retired after 29 years of service with the Blount County School System. She was an avid supporter of Special Olympics. She worked at Dollywood for 17 years. Helen was an active member of the American Legion Auxiliary for 40 years. She loved going to the Lady Vols basketball games for over 30 years.
